
SCC attends Energy Forum in Kazakhstan
Energy disputes will be specifically addressed by SCC Secretary General Annette Magnusson at the 10th edition of Kazenergy Eurasian Forum in Astana, Kazakhstan 29 September – 1 October.
The theme of this year’s Energy Forum is “New Energy Horizons: Prospects of Cooperation and Investments”. Central points of discussion during this meeting will be the current development and challenges within the energy sphere, including the development of long-term trade-economic and energy partnerships in order to create global energy stability.
SCC Secretary General Annette Magnusson will address investment arbitration and effective dispute resolution of energy disputes in a round table discussion with representatives from government, organisations and energy companies. The panel will include:

An introductive discussion on basic mechanisms of the regulations of energy disputes, as well as for encouragement and protection of energy investments.

Debate on issues concerning international energy disputes –from a government as well as business perspective.
This year, participants from over 80 companies within the energy sector, and representatives from government, organizations and institutions, researcher and academics will attend the meeting.
